Output 59ed633d5200572000122038c9128478f0c0728ef8bd2947d3ff9aaa6e58df77:118

value
9607
script pubkey
OP_0 OP_PUSHBYTES_20 894d8cbb40d3cc0b81d52d4bda24b03b9b4a4bf0
address
bc1q39xcew6q60xqhqw4949a5f9s8wd55jls4tlkpx
transaction
59ed633d5200572000122038c9128478f0c0728ef8bd2947d3ff9aaa6e58df77
spent
true